Course Details
• Wind Energy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of wind energy, including the physics of wind, wind resources assessment, and the different types of wind turbines.
• Wind Farm Design and Engineering: Learning the principles of wind farm design, including site selection, layout optimization, and electrical system engineering.
• Project Development and Financing: Exploring the process of developing and financing wind farm projects, including feasibility studies, permitting, and financial modeling.
• Operations and Maintenance: Understanding the best practices for operating and maintaining wind farms, including monitoring and diagnostics, preventive maintenance, and troubleshooting.
• Regulatory and Policy Environment: Getting familiar with the regulatory and policy landscape for wind energy, including federal and state policies, incentives, and permitting requirements.
• Stakeholder Engagement and Community Relations: Learning how to engage with stakeholders, including local communities, indigenous groups, and other interested parties, and manage conflicts and communications effectively.
• Sustainability and Environmental Considerations: Understanding the environmental and sustainability considerations for wind farms, including biodiversity, wildlife, and land use.
• Emerging Technologies and Trends: Exploring the latest trends and emerging technologies in wind energy, including offshore wind, energy storage, and digitalization.
